School Safety Plan

At CCRMS, school safety is a top priority. The school emergency & safety plan was created in August to ensure the safety of students and staff. The Big Five team meets regularly to review the plan and design monthly emergency drills such as Earthquake Drills, Fire Drills, Secure Campus, Lockdown/Barricade, and Campus Evacuation. The emergency plan contains responsibilities for certificated personnel, emergency procedures, emergency telephone numbers, and emergency communication signals that will alert students and staff in case of an emergency. Each classroom has an emergency kit and classroom evacuation map. All teachers have an emergency folder that includes emergency procedures, student rosters, signal cards, and other important safety information. Safety information is shared with students during Advisory Classes and via ParentSquare. Our school works closely with the East Palo Alto Police Department and Menlo Park Fire Department.
